Tech Lead
Apr 2025 — Present
Technical Lead for Setu’s Bill Payments (BBPS) Platform that handles payments worth over INR 70k crore every month; responsible for architecture, scale, reliability and delivery- Brought down p99 API latency for the customer-facing product from ~3 sec to <150ms supporting peak load of 750+ bill fetches/sec, 150+ payments/sec and overall requests per second (includes status polling APIs). Reduced DB contention by partitioning hot tables, caching intermediate state & moving to “cache + ack first, persist later” design- Reduced AWS spend by per month for the merchant-facing product by refactoring data model/schema for a critical request flow with zero downtime- Actively contributed in the design and build of the MCP server as a wrapper over existing bill payment APIs- Partnered with the EM/PMs and stakeholders on roadmap and capacity planning- Coached junior engineers on incident triage and settlement workflows, enabling them to resolve issues independently; improving on-call confidence- Drove a merge-request hygiene push by running an MR cleanup sprint; built a Lambda + Slack bot that flags MRs pending for more than 4 days and notifies the team- Identified and owned tech debt work across sprints/roadmaps to improve cost efficiency, maintainability, reliability and developer productivity- Led RabbitMQ to SQS migration, reducing queueing infra costs by ~50%.
